For many people, weight loss begins with grand promises: no sugar, 5 a.m. workouts, strict meal plans and a determination that lasts exactly until the next stressful week. Then reality returns. The problem is not always motivation. Often, it is the size of the change itself. That is why health experts are increasingly paying attention to something far less dramatic but surprisingly effective: microhabits. These are tiny actions repeated consistently — drinking water before meals, taking a short walk after eating or adding protein to breakfast. On their own, they seem almost too small to matter. But together, they can reshape the way people eat, move and respond to hunger without the emotional exhaustion that often comes with aggressive dieting. Why Small Changes Work Better ...
